CodeQL Action Changelog
See the releases page for the relevant changes to the CodeQL CLI and language packs.
Note that the only difference between
v2andv3of the CodeQL Action is the node version they support, withv3running on node 20 while we continue to releasev2to support running on node 16. For example3.22.11was the firstv3release and is functionally identical to2.22.11. This approach ensures an easy way to track exactly which features are included in different versions, indicated by the minor and patch version numbers.[UNRELEASED]

3.23.0 - 08 Jan 2024
- We are rolling out a feature in January 2024 that will disable Python dependency installation by default for all users. This improves the speed of analysis while having only a very minor impact on results. You can override this behavior by setting
CODEQL_ACTION_DISABLE_PYTHON_DEPENDENCY_INSTALLATION=falsein your workflow, however we plan to remove this ability in future versions of the CodeQL Action. #2031- The CodeQL Action now requires CodeQL version 2.11.6 or later. For more information, see the corresponding changelog entry for CodeQL Action version 2.22.7. #2009
